First of all, the K2 s-meter is just a little bit less sensitive than 
the one on my TS850.  Hardly a big deal, and as you well know, S-meters 
vary all over the map.

Secondly, the one who should be embarassed is the guy who made a big 
deal about it!  If he's old enough to be allowed to operate an Alpha 99 
he should know that S-meters are only useful for relative comparisons 
and therefore it doesn't matter if one is a bit stingy and another 
generous.  This has been discussed over and over on the reflector, and I 
personally have been listing to complaints, etc. about S-meters since 1956.
